Product Overview & Official Specifications
This Arlo Camera Mount is engineered for precise positioning of Arlo security cameras in both indoor and outdoor environments. It features a 360-degree swivel and 90-degree tilt for full coverage, with a 5-inch extension from mounting surfaces. Compatible with nearly all Arlo camera models â including Essential, Pro, Ultra, and Go series â it comes with an outdoor mount, three mounting screws, and an Arlo window decal for easy setup. The mount is designed for quick installation and long-term reliability, with durable materials that withstand typical weather conditions.

| Feature | Specification |
|---|---|
| Adjustment Range | 360-degree swivel, 90-degree tilt |
| Extension Length | 5 inches from mounting surface |
| Compatible Models | Essential, Essential Spotlight, Essential Spotlight XL, Pro 5S 2K, Pro 4, Pro 3, Pro 2, Pro, Pro 4 XL, Ultra 2, Ultra, Ultra 2 XL, Go 2, Go, and Arlo cameras |
| Mounting Hardware | Three mounting screws, outdoor mount, Arlo window decal |
| Weather Resistance | Basic outdoor resistance â not for extreme weather |
| Material | Robust plastic and metal construction |
| Weight | Official spec not disclosed |
| Dimensions | Official spec not disclosed |
| Price | $19.19 |

Build Quality & Material Performance
The mountâs plastic and metal construction feels solid and durable. After 30 days of daily use, including exposure to rain and sunlight, thereâs no visible degradation. The mounting surface remains secure, and the camera stays locked in place during adjustments. However, the plastic components are not designed for extreme weather â no IP rating or waterproofing beyond basic outdoor resistance. For users in regions with heavy snow or storms, this mount is not a long-term solution.

Installation Experience & Compatibility
Setup took 10 minutes with basic tools. The included screws and outdoor mount made installation straightforward. The Arlo window decal simplified mounting on glass or smooth surfaces. Compatibility was flawless â I tested it with a Pro 5S 2K, Ultra 2, and Go 2, and each mounted securely. The only caveat: the mount is not designed for non-Arlo cameras â if youâre using a third-party camera, you may need a different mount.
